About Us

Founded by Philipe Bruce in Nebraska, this initiative has grown from a local celebration into a national movement to honor and inspire individuals aged 50 and over. As people reach a stage in life where experience, wisdom, and achievements take center stage, this platform honors their remarkable contributions across diverse fields such as Business Leadership, Community Service, Healthcare and Wellness, Arts and Culture, and Innovation and Technology.

​

The 50 Over 50 Awards provides a space to showcase the impact that individuals over 50 continue to make in our society, proving that age is no barrier to success. Through our events, we highlight the stories of those who have excelled in their respective fields, inspiring others to pursue their passions and make a difference, no matter their age.

AWARD CATEGORIES

  • Business Leadership Award: This award recognizes individuals who have demonstrated exceptional leadership and innovation in the business world, driving economic growth and fostering entrepreneurship.

  • Healthcare & Wellness Award: Honors those who have significantly contributed to health and wellness, whether through medical innovation, mental health advocacy, or community healthcare services.

  • Innovation & Technology Award: This award celebrates leaders who have driven technological advancements or innovation in their fields, pushing the boundaries of what's possible.

  • Community Service Award: This award recognizes individuals who have made a lasting impact on their communities through volunteer work, nonprofit leadership, or advocacy for social change.

  • Arts & Culture Award: Honors individuals who have enriched their communities through artistic expression, cultural preservation, or creative leadership.

AWARD PROCESS

  1. Nomination Process

  • Eligibility Requirements: Nominees must be at least 50 years old and demonstrate remarkable accomplishments in one or more categories: Business Leadership, Healthcare & Wellness, Innovation & Technology, Community Service, or Arts & Culture. Each nominee should exemplify high standards of excellence, innovation, and impact within their category.

  • Nomination Committee: Each year, a dedicated nomination committee actively researches and surveys community leaders to identify exceptional candidates. We also welcome public nominations, allowing anyone to submit a candidate who meets our award criteria.

  • How to Nominate: To nominate someone, please visit the Nomination Form linked on each award city’s page. Nominees must include a bio and summary of achievements in their chosen category. Nomination deadlines vary by city and can be found on each respective city’s page.

 

2 . Review and Judging

  • Judging Panel: Each event assembles a new judging panel, composed of community representatives, sponsors, and invited experts. Panel members are announced on an ongoing basis throughout the nomination timeline, adding transparency to the selection process.

  • Evaluation Criteria: Judges score nominees on specific criteria such as leadership, community impact, innovation, dedication, and overall achievement.

  • Top 50 Selection: After a thorough review, the top 50 nominees are selected as award recipients for the 50 Over 50 Awards based on their merits and impact. The list of honorees will be publicly announced before the gala, celebrating their achievements and building anticipation for the event.

 

3. The Gala Announcement

  • Congratulatory Ceremony: All 50 awardees are honored at the gala, where they receive formal recognition, an award plaque, and a congratulatory letter celebrating their accomplishments.

  • Lifetime Achievement Award: Out of the 50 award recipients, those with the highest scores from the initial judging round will be further reviewed by the judging panel for the prestigious Lifetime Achievement Award. This special honor is then announced with the announcement of the nonprofit they have chosen to receive our donation (See Community Giving section below).

COMMUNITY GIVING

  1. Mission Statement

At 50 Over 50 Awards, our mission is to honor and celebrate individuals aged 50 and older who are making a profound impact in their communities through leadership, innovation, and service. By recognizing these individuals, we aim to inspire intergenerational collaboration, challenge outdated perceptions of aging, and elevate the contributions of those whose wisdom and experience drive meaningful change.

​

As part of our commitment to giving back, we donate a portion of our proceeds to a nonprofit organization that aligns with our values. As you can see, community-driven decision-making and transparency is part of all of our processes. For that reason, we allow The Lifetime Achievement Award recipient to select the nonprofit our donation goes to each year, ensuring that the cause reflects the legacy and leadership we celebrate.

 

2 . Nonprofit Selection Criteria:

 

The nonprofit chosen must:

​

  • Be a registered 501(c)(3) organization in good standing.

  • Align with the values of the 50 Over 50 Awards, supporting causes that contribute to community enrichment, social impact, or public well-being.

  • Have a local or regional impact, strengthening the communities our honorees serve.

  • Be nonpartisan and non-political, ensuring inclusivity for all.

  • Accept and use donations for direct community support rather than administrative costs.

​​

By empowering the Lifetime Achievement Award recipient to make this selection, we continue our commitment to impartiality and community-led impact, ensuring that every year, the 50 Over 50 Awards uplifts a cause that matters most to the individuals who inspire us.
